- The distance between Karachi, Pakistan and Maceio, Brazil is approximately 11,729 km or 7,289 mi.
- To reach Karachi in this distance one would set out from Maceio bearing 66.8° or ENE and follow the great circles arc to approach Karachi bearing 86.3° or E .
- Karachi has a subtropical hot desert climate (BWh) whereas Maceio has a tropical monsoonal climate (Am).
- The average temperature is 1.3 °C (2.3°F) warmer.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 8 °C (14.4°F) more in Karachi. The continentality subtype is barely hyperoceanic as opposed to extremely hyperoceanic.
- Total annual precipitation averages 2000 mm (78.7 in) less which is equivalent to 2000 l/m² (49.08 US gal/ft²) or 20,000,000 l/ha (2,138,133 US gal/ac) less. About 0 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 7.9° lower in Karachi than in Maceio.
- Relative humidity levels are 2.4% lower.
- The mean dew point temperature is 0.7°C (1.3°F) higher.
